First Presbyterian Church of Boise Seating Chart – Best Seats & Views
A Historic Venue for Worship and Performances
The First Presbyterian Church of Boise is a landmark venue known for its stunning architecture and exceptional acoustics, hosting worship services, concerts, and community events. Its intimate setting ensures a memorable experience, but choosing the right seat is key to enjoying the event fully.
Seating Chart Overview
✅ Main Sanctuary (Center Sections)
- Advantages: Unobstructed views, ideal for choir and organ performances.
- Drawbacks: Limited legroom in some pews.
✅ Balcony Sections
- Advantages: Elevated view, great for overall sightlines.
- Drawbacks: Further from the stage, may feel less immersive.
Best Seats for Different Events
- Concerts: Front-center pews for close-up views.
- Worship Services: Mid-sanctuary for balanced acoustics.
- Lectures: Balcony for a clear view of the podium.
Seat Views & Potential Obstructions
- Front Rows: Excellent visibility but may require slight neck tilt for choir loft viewing.
- Side Pews: Slightly angled views; pillars may obstruct sightlines in rear sections.
VIP & Accessibility Options
- VIP Seating: Reserved front pews with priority access.
- Accessibility: Wheelchair-accessible seating in the rear and side sections.
Tips for Choosing Seats
For budget-friendly options, consider mid-balcony seats. If acoustics are a priority, center sanctuary pews are ideal. Always check the venue’s seating map for potential obstructions before booking.
